#4e173e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e173e is composed of 30.6% red, 9%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.5% magenta, 20.5% yellow and 69.4% black. It has a hue angle of 317.5 degrees, a saturation of 54.5% and a lightness of 19.8%. #4e173e color hex could be obtained by blending #9c2e7c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

● #4e173e color description : Very dark pink.
#4e173e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4e173e has RGB values of R:78, G:23,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.71, Y:0.21,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 5117758.

Shades and Tints of #4e173e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#fbf2f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e173e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#333233 is the less saturated color, while #610446 is the most saturated one.
